2.2.5 Static
With the S70G is possible also perform a static session, then post process the
observations and calculate a control point with accuracy.
For the Static it is recommended the use of the pole and the external A45
antenna.
This configuration is specific for these kinds of job and for RTK jobs with
accuracy position during the survey or the stake out.
After configured the system, place the rover on the control point.
Then open the working mode and select Rover.

STONEX S70G Specifications

General IconGeneral
TypeGNSS Receiver
Initialization Reliability>99.9%
Data Update RateUp to 20 Hz
Operating Temperature-40°C to +65°C
VibrationMIL-STD-810G
Ingress ProtectionIP67
Tilt SensorYes
Battery TypeLi-ion
Charging Time4 hours
ModelS70G
Frequency BandsGPS L1/L2, GLONASS L1/L2, BeiDou B1/B2, Galileo E1/E5b, QZSS L1/L2/L5
Channels336
Static Accuracy Horizontal2.5 mm + 0.5 ppm
Static Accuracy Vertical5 mm + 0.5 ppm
RTK Accuracy Horizontal8 mm + 1 ppm
RTK Accuracy Vertical15 mm + 1 ppm
Code Differential Accuracy0.25 m
Initialization Time10 s
Storage Temperature-40°C to +80°C
CommunicationBluetooth, Wi-Fi, 4G
Data FormatsRTCM 3.3, CMR, CMR+, NMEA-0183
